No varnish
Tropical fruit fermented in milk isn't a combination anyone asked for, but it's the whole point. If Byredo Pulp had a louder cousin with more cactus and equal parts cannabis, this would be it.Mexican Cactus
Jany does not try to be anything other than what it is: a warm, fruit-forward comfort scent. The apple, peach and apricot in the opening are sweet from the start with no sharp tartness to them.Jany
